如何命令挂载脱机磁盘?_挂载磁盘步骤详解

在Linux中,可以使用mount命令来挂载脱机磁盘。如果你想挂载一个名为/dev/sdb1的磁盘到/mnt/mydisk目录,可以使用以下命令:,,“bash,sudo mount /dev/sdb1 /mnt/mydisk,“,,请确保你有足够的权限来执行这个操作,并且目标挂载点已经存在。

在Linux操作系统中,挂载磁盘是一个常见且重要的操作,通过挂载磁盘,我们可以将外部存储设备(如硬盘、U盘等)连接到文件系统,从而能够访问和操作这些设备上的文件和目录,以下是关于如何在Linux系统中挂载脱机磁盘的详细步骤和相关信息。

如何命令挂载脱机磁盘?_挂载磁盘步骤详解

查看磁盘信息

在挂载磁盘之前,首先需要了解系统中可用的磁盘信息,可以使用以下命令来查看:

sudo fdisk -l

该命令会列出系统中所有的磁盘及其分区信息,通过此命令,可以确定要挂载的磁盘或分区的设备名,例如/dev/sdb1

创建挂载点

挂载点是用于将磁盘与文件系统关联的目录,在挂载磁盘之前,我们需要创建一个挂载点,可以使用以下命令来创建挂载点:

sudo mkdir /mnt/mydisk

上述命令将在/mnt目录下创建一个名为mydisk的目录作为挂载点,你可以根据需要选择其他目录作为挂载点。

挂载磁盘

一旦确定了要挂载的磁盘和创建了挂载点,就可以使用以下命令来挂载磁盘:

sudo mount /dev/sdb1 /mnt/mydisk

上述命令将/dev/sdb1分区挂载到/mnt/mydisk目录下,需要将/dev/sdb1替换为你要挂载的磁盘设备名,将/mnt/mydisk替换为你创建的挂载点。

检查挂载情况

挂载完成后,可以使用以下命令来检查挂载情况:

df -h

该命令将列出系统中所有已挂载的文件系统及其使用情况,你可以查看输出结果确认磁盘是否成功挂载。

卸载磁盘

如果需要卸载已挂载的磁盘,可以使用以下命令:

如何命令挂载脱机磁盘?_挂载磁盘步骤详解

sudo umount /mnt/mydisk

上述命令将卸载/mnt/mydisk目录下挂载的磁盘,你需要将/mnt/mydisk替换为你的挂载点。

开机自动挂载

除了手动挂载磁盘,还可以通过编辑/etc/fstab文件来实现开机自动挂载,在该文件中添加相应的条目,即可实现开机自动挂载指定的设备文件到指定的挂载点。

/dev/sdb1 /mnt/mydisk ext4 defaults 0 0

这样,在系统引导时,会自动获取/dev/sdb1磁盘或分区的文件系统类型、挂载选项等信息,并将其挂载到/mnt/mydisk

常见问题及解决方法

Q1: 如何挂载只读文件系统?

A1: 要在挂载时指定文件系统为只读模式,可以在mount命令中使用-o ro选项。

sudo mount -o ro /dev/sdb1 /mnt/mydisk

Q2: 如果磁盘处于脱机状态怎么办?

A2: 如果磁盘处于脱机状态,可以使用DISKPART工具将其设置为在线状态,具体步骤如下:

1、打开命令行窗口,输入DISKPART并按回车。

2、输入san policy=onlineall设置策略为所有在线状态。

如何命令挂载脱机磁盘?_挂载磁盘步骤详解

3、输入list disk列出磁盘列表。

4、输入select disk X选中需要操作的磁盘(X为磁盘编号)。

5、输入attributes disk clear readonly清除只读状态。

6、输入online disk设置磁盘在线状态。

通过以上步骤,可以将脱机磁盘设置为在线状态并进行后续的挂载操作。

小编有话说

通过以上内容,我们详细介绍了在Linux系统中挂载脱机磁盘的方法和步骤,挂载磁盘是一项基本但非常重要的技能,特别是在服务器运维和管理中,无论是为了扩展存储空间,还是访问外部设备,掌握这一技能都是必不可少的,希望本文对你有所帮助,如果你有任何问题或建议,欢迎留言讨论!

原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/1460932.html

本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

(0)
未希
上一篇 2025-01-05 12:42
下一篇 2025-01-05 12:45

相关推荐

  • 如何在Linux系统上删除Oracle实例?

    在 Linux 系统中删除 Oracle 实例,通常需要执行以下步骤:,,1. 停止 Oracle 服务。,2. 使用 dbca 工具删除数据库实例。,3. 清理相关文件和目录。,4. 更新环境变量。,,具体操作如下:,,“bash,# 停止 Oracle 服务,sudo systemctl stop oracle-xe-11g,,# 使用 dbca 工具删除数据库实例,sudo /u01/app/oracle/product/11.2.0/xe/bin/dbca -silent -deleteDatabase -sourceDB,,# 清理相关文件和目录,sudo rm -rf /u01/app/oracle/oradata/,sudo rm -rf /u01/app/oracle/admin/,sudo rm -rf /u01/app/oracle/flash_recovery_area/,,# 更新环境变量,echo “export ORACLE_HOME=/u01/app/oracle/product/11.2.0/xe” ˃˃ ~/.bashrc,echo “export PATH=\$ORACLE_HOME/bin:\$PATH” ˃˃ ~/.bashrc,source ~/.bashrc,`,,请将 ` 替换为实际的 SID。

    2024-11-15
    0118
  • 如何在Debian系统中安装Docker?

    在Debian上安装Docker,首先更新包列表并安装必要的依赖,然后下载并安装Docker的官方软件包。

    2024-10-11
    037
  • 如何正确安装MySQL数据库,一步步命令指南

    安装MySQL的命令是:sudo aptget install mysqlserver。

    2024-10-10
    014

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

产品购买 QQ咨询 微信咨询 SEO优化
分享本页
返回顶部
云产品限时秒杀。精选云产品高防服务器,20M大带宽限量抢购 >>点击进入